About DS.Densi MAXI

DS.Densi MAXI works on the principle of dual-energy X-ray absorptiometry (DEXA) with a fan beam — the recognized gold standard for diagnosing osteoporosis. The unit measures bone mineral density (BMD) in the standard regions — the lumbar spine, proximal femur and forearm — and additionally performs a compositional analysis of the whole body, determining the ratio of fat, muscle and bone tissue with region-of-interest selection.

A distinctive capability of the MAXI is lateral-projection scanning of the lumbar spine with measurement of vertebral heights and intervertebral spaces. This is critical for detecting compression fractures, which often go unnoticed in the standard anteroposterior projection. The table withstands up to 260 kg, so patients with severe obesity can be examined, and the built-in FRAX program calculates each patient’s individual ten-year risk of osteoporotic fractures from clinical factors.

For a clinic, DS.Densi MAXI is more than osteodensitometry: the whole-body scanning function extends the service line to diagnostics of sarcopenia, internal-organ fibrosis and metabolic syndrome. Frequently asked questions

Why is DEXA considered the gold standard of osteoporosis diagnostics?
Dual-energy X-ray absorptiometry detects changes in bone mineral density with about 2% precision — long before clinical symptoms appear, whereas conventional radiography reveals osteoporosis only after 25–30% of bone mass is already lost.
Which patients can be examined on DS.Densi MAXI?
The table load capacity of 260 kg allows examinations of patients with severe obesity. Standard indications include postmenopausal women, men over 50, patients on glucocorticosteroids and anyone with a history of low-energy fractures.
